"Stargate SG-1" Season 01, Episode 03, Emancipation
7/10
8th August 1997
Written By: Katharyn Michaeilian Powers
Directed By: Jeff Woolnough
While on a routine exploration mission SG-1 saves the life of a young man from a pack of wild dogs. The young man is very grateful, but upon discovering that Captain Samantha Carter is a woman things take an unexpected and unwelcome turn.
Once again alien cultures are presented as speaking fluent English even when they culturally and geographically should not know it even before being relocated by the Goa'uld. A plot shortcut, I am sure. Spending the entire episode learning the language, having Doctor Daniel Jackson translating, or making the actors take language lessons in a possible extinct language would be too time consuming and boring.
The episode also introduces the recurring theme of the peoples of Earth trying to impose their views onto other cultures. It went well in this episode, but not all cultures are quite as accepting.
Additionally, it is one of the few episodes where close quarters combat is shown. For the most part all battles involve shooting some kind of weapon at distances farther than five meters.
The acting talent is acceptable, the effects are low level physical stunts and pyrotechnics, the plot is more or less a culturally different Romeo & Juliet.
